经典文献 -> 周易 -> 文言 -> -> 23

The great man is he who is in harmony, in his attributes, with heaven and earth; in his brightness, with the sun and moon; in his orderly procedure, with the four sea-sons; and in his relation to what is fortunate and what is calamitous, in harmony with the spirit-like operations (of Providence).
He may precede Heaven, and Heaven will not act in opposition to him; he may follow Heaven, but will act (only) as Heaven at the time would do.
If Heaven will not act in opposition to him, how much less will men!
how much less will the spirit-like operation (of Providence)!
